Career path
| Career Role in IoT Predictive Maintenance | Description |
|---|---|
| IoT Predictive Maintenance Engineer (Metalworking) | Develops and implements IoT-based predictive maintenance solutions for metalworking assembly lines, leveraging sensor data and machine learning algorithms to optimize equipment uptime and reduce downtime. High demand for problem-solving skills and experience with industrial automation. |
| Data Scientist (Predictive Maintenance) | Analyzes large datasets from connected metalworking machinery, builds predictive models to anticipate equipment failures, and collaborates with engineers to implement preventative measures. Strong analytical and programming skills are crucial. |
| Senior IoT Consultant (Industrial Automation) | Provides expert advice on implementing IoT-based predictive maintenance strategies for clients in the metalworking industry. Extensive experience in industrial IoT architectures and data analytics are necessary. |
| Machine Learning Engineer (Metalworking) | Designs, develops, and deploys machine learning models for predicting equipment failures in metalworking assembly processes. Expertise in relevant programming languages (Python, R) and machine learning algorithms is essential. |
